Bemiparin

Uses of Bemiparin

Bemiparin is an anticoagulant medicine used to prevent and treat blood clots.

Bemiparin is commonly used for:

• Deep vein thrombosis: Prevents and treats blood clots that form in the deep veins, usually in the legs.
• Treatment of deep vein thrombosis with or without pulmonary embolism: Helps manage blood clots that may travel to the lungs.
• Prevention of blood clots after surgery: Reduces the risk of clot formation in patients undergoing general or orthopaedic surgery.

How Bemiparin works

Bemiparin works by preventing the blood from clotting too easily.

It is a low molecular weight heparin. It boosts the activity of antithrombin III, a natural anticoagulant in the body, which then blocks clotting factor Xa and, to a lesser extent, factor IIa (thrombin).

By reducing the formation of fibrin, the protein that forms the mesh of a blood clot, Bemiparin helps prevent existing clots from growing and reduces the risk of new clots forming.

Dosage Forms Available

  • Bemiparin is available as an injectable solution to be administered directly under the skin (subcutaneous administration). This formulation ensures that the medicine is absorbed into the bloodstream efficiently.

Age and Dose Restrictions

  • Bemiparin is intended for use in adult patients only. It is not recommended for children due to the specific dosing and monitoring required.

Contraindications

  • Bemiparin is contraindicated in patients with active major bleeding.

  • It is also contraindicated in patients with a history of heparin-induced thrombocytopenia (HIT).

  • Bemiparin should not be used in individuals with severe uncontrolled hypertension.

  • Patients with known hypersensitivity to Bemiparin or any low molecular weight heparins should avoid this medication.

Other Medications to Avoid

  • This medicine can interact with antiplatelet agents (such as aspirin, and clopidogrel), NSAIDs (such as ibuprofen, and naproxen), thrombolytic agents (such as alteplase, and reteplase), and other anticoagulants (like warfarin, dabigatran).

Caution in Other Conditions

  • Patients with renal impairment should use Bemiparin with caution due to increased risks of bleeding.

  • Those with liver disorders must also be cautious because liver problems can alter how this medicine is metabolized and excreted from the body.
